i'm coming from the iPhone world, to the droid world and i'm wondering if there's a reason i'm not receiving group texts from other iPhones. Thanks for any help.

Just a thought, but maybe some iphone users are using your email for imessage and therefore you will not receive any texts unless they ensure they have your cell number in your contact info.
 
make sure all your devices that have imessage delete your cell number from preferences
 
I had this problem when switching from an Android phone last year. People would text me from their iphones and my new Android phone wouldn't get the text. I struggled with this problem for weeks and went up to Tier 3 tech support on Verizon and Apple and stumped them all on this. It was like my texts were in a permanent state of limbo stuck in iMessage world. Apple told me to wait 45 days and it would time out at their server. I almost lost it on the person asking them if they would be able to not get texts from their freinds and family for 45 days? They soon saw my point and were willing to help as techinicaly at that point I wasn't an Apple customer anymore with my new Android phone.
An Apple tech got back to me after doing some internal testing after a day and said I had to activate my # back onto an iphone at the Verizon store and turn on iMessage, then turn it off and then switch my # back onto my Android phone. I was willing to try anything as I was so disgusted that no one could help me. Sure enough it worked, however the Verizon store employee gave me a weird look when trying to explain why I had to activate my # onto a demo phone in his stock and then back to mine. After some discussion she let me and sure enough it worked.

So anyone switching from an iphone to Android make sure you TURN OFF iMessage before you switch your ESN / # over to the new Android phone.
